Hi all,
KRLS and I have been working on a tool to count the number of points for
the proofreading contest organized in Catalan wikisource, which could prove
useful for others running the contest. There are no bugs that we know of,
but beware for it comes with no warranty ;-).
The code can be found at
http://pastebin.com/gkPVLDHB and uses
pywikipedia's latest version ("core"/"rewrite"). You can also
find
annotations on what is to be changed for other editions. Basically,
variables "llibres" and "end" need to be replaced by whatever books
are
used, and the length of each. You should also take into account the fact
that it uses UTC time; adapt lines 71, 77 and 80 to your needs.
I think that's all. In case you find bugs or need some extra features
count with KRLS and me.
